And then in the real world things are not quite so simple. I suspect there are quite a few quite large companies that have in the past heavily invested in Solaris on SPARC who either are finding it hard or don't see a reason to migrate off that platform.
If you ignore the uncertainty a while back thanks to Oracle's mixed messages, the roadmap for SPARC has been public and Oracle has stuck to it. So for many companies there isn't a compelling need to move away from hardware/OS point of view. T5 actually is not a bad processor and now with two PCI root complexes actually makes for much better base for consolidation with LDOMs without single point of failure.

Correctly written Solaris software should only require a recompile between x86 and SPARC.
You can develop on x86 and recompile for SPARC. There are numerous open source Solaris distros out there, for isntance SmartOS, OmniOS, OpenIndiana, etc.
Of these, SmartOS and OmniOS seem most compelling. SmartOS is developed by Joyent, the company behind nodejs and the newly released Manta, which is similar to hadoop but with a unique twist, so it is much easier to analyse Big Data than ever before:
http://www.joyent.com/blog/hello-manta-bringing-unix-to-big-data
SmartOS also has several defected Solaris kernel devs from Sun, such as creator of ZFS, creator of DTrace, etc. They have probably the best Solaris knowledge outside Oracle. The CloudOS SmartOS uses KVM so you can run different Zones for higher security (all these zones can now analyse big data, see above)
